San Diego Padres New Era MLB 59FIFTY 5950 Fitted Cap Hat Sky Blue Crown/Visor White/Blue Azzure Logo 50th Anniversary Side Patch Blue Azzure UV

$45.99

Size Chartssize guide
  • Estimated delivery: 11-09 ~ 11-12
#